Question (a) A CRC is constructed to generate a 4-bit FCS for an 11-bit message. The divisor polynomial is X4 + X3 + 1
(i) Encode the data bit sequence 00111011001 using polynomial division and give the code word.
(ii) Assume that 7th MSB in the data bit sequence above gets corrupted during transmission, show how the detection algorithm detects the error.
Question (b) What is the difference between Synchronous TDM and Statistical TDM?
(c) In respect to HDLC:
(i) State the three data transfer modes of operation.(ii) Give the structure of generic HDLC frame.(iii) Explain why HDLC uses 'bit stuffing'.
Question (d) With the aid of sketches, explain the difference between the following two transmission modes used with optical fibre:
(i) Graded-index Multi-mode and
(ii) Mono-mode.
